<br><br><br>Outdoor lighting continues to evolve in 2024, merging practicality and aesthetics to enhance both safety and ambiance in exterior spaces. Homeowners and landscape designers are embracing new technologies and styles that not only illuminate pathways and gardens but also enhance the visual character of outdoor environments. Here are the top trends shaping outdoor lighting this year.<br><br><br><br>One of the most prominent trends is the increasing popularity of connected outdoor lights. Integrated with Wi-Fi and compatible with voice assistants like Alexa and Google Assistant, smart outdoor lights offer customizable control over illumination settings through apps or voice commands. These systems can be configured to switch on automatically at nightfall, simulate presence during vacations, or produce ambient lighting for social events.<br><br><br><br>Energy efficiency remains a top priority, and LED lighting is now the standard. LEDs consume less power, have a greater longevity and produce reduced thermal output compared to incandescent options. In 2024, manufacturers are focusing on expanding the range of warmth levels, offering softer hues ideal for relaxation—well-suited to decks and dining zones.<br><br><br><br>Another growing trend is the use of solar-powered lights. Advances in solar panel efficiency mean that these lights now perform reliably even in areas with limited sunlight. From garden stakes to hanging fairy lights, solar options are becoming more durable and stylish, making them a responsible option for those reducing their carbon footprint.<br><br><br><br>Minimalist design is influencing outdoor fixtures as well. Discreet lighting elements designed to complement modern architecture are gaining popularity. Embedded riser lights, linear lighting on walkways, and flush-mounted ground lamps contribute to a clean, modern look without sacrificing illumination.<br><br><br><br>Landscape accent lighting is also taking center stage. Purposefully installed highlighters and upward projectors highlight trees, shrubs, and architectural elements, creating layers of visual interest. This technique not only enhances nighttime curb appeal but also invites exploration and defines pathways.<br><br><br><br>Color-tunable lighting is emerging as a favorite for entertainment areas. These lights allow users to adjust the color based on the atmosphere desired, from cool blue for a refreshing summer vibe to soft orange for romantic or relaxed evenings. Some systems even offer programmable light shows for celebrations.<br><br><br><br>Finally, durability and weather resistance are key considerations. With fixtures exposed to rain, snow, and temperature fluctuations, materials like weather-sealed aluminum, [https://www.svijet-svjetiljki.hr PARTIZANI] marine-grade steel, and durable thermoplastics are being widely used. These materials guarantee lasting reliability and minimize upkeep.<br><br><br><br>As outdoor living spaces become extensions of the home, intentional illumination is essential. The trends of 2024 reflect a balance of innovation, sustainability, and style—transforming backyards, gardens, and entryways into beautifully lit environments that are both functional and enchanting.<br><br>
